Switched Live

A 'switched live' is an electrical signal given out by a component when an intenal switch 'makes'. For example, a room thermostat will have a permanent live supply to it but will only give out a switch live output when the temperature is low.
Switched Lives can be mains voltage, and as such should be sleeved, irrespective of wire colour.
